Output 28924443a888fe391e09100f074a12329ffe6cc0d8afeeba0ec6bc4f7d1aab86:2

value
11433413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4289c757c6c404b954c2b96865457e4209c3ef1 OP_EQUAL
address
3J7cCnaUMpQu1PFKo1d5wafz8axU3H1Thx
transaction
28924443a888fe391e09100f074a12329ffe6cc0d8afeeba0ec6bc4f7d1aab86
spent
true